Spontaneous bacteremia
common event (flossing, brushing teeth) that creates small lacerations allowing small amt of bacteria to enter the blood (minutes)
Transient bacteremia
trauma to a heavily colonized mucosal surface resulting in bacteria entering into the blood (hours)
Intermittent/Recurrent bacteremia
foci of infection (staph abscess) causing there to be bacteria in the blood occasionally
Continuous bacteremia:
certain diseases cause there to be bacteria in the blood continuously
Causes of Continuous bacteremia:
• Infective endocarditis, typhoid fever, anthrax, rickettsia, pyelonephritis, bacterial meningitis
Organs that clear bacteria from blood
liver & spleen
_______________ kill bacteria in the liver and spleen
Kupffer cells + PMNs
Asplenics are particularly susceptible
bacteremia, particularly those w/ capsules

Diagnosis of Bacteremia
Blood specimen collected 2-3 separate times over a 24hr period , >15m apart, before Abx Tx, before/during fever spike
Native Valve Endocarditis
most common, occurs in pts w/o hx of IVDU or prosthetic valve
Native Valve Endocarditis valves affected
mitral, aortic
Risks for Native Valve Endocarditis
mitral valve prolapse, congenital or acquired heart defects, rheumatic heart disease
Pathogenesis of Native Valve Endocarditis
turbulent BF -> deposition of fibrin/proteins/etc -> contamination of damaged heart valve secondary to bacteremia
Agents of Native Valve Endocarditis
Strep —> CoNS, S. aureus, GNR, S. pneumo, GAS
